Abstract:
This paper addresses the problem of phase-noise estimation and mitigation in full-duplex radio transceivers. It has been shown before that the phase-noise is one of the most critical factors limiting the self-interference suppression performance in full-duplex radio transceivers. In this paper, an algorithm is proposed for the phase-noise estimation and mitigation. The algorithm has high estimation quality and low computational complexity, and it does not require synchronization of the useful and self-interference signals, so it is applicable also in long-range communications. The performance of the algorithm is then evaluated and compared to the performance of the state-of-theart algorithm with extensive computer simulations.
